Relationships between leisure time physical activity and perceived stress

S G Aldana1, L D Sutton, B H Jacobson

  • 1Department of Physical Education, Brigham Young University, Provo, UT 84602-2214. aldanas@pegate.byu.edu

Summary

Engaging in regular leisure-time physical activity significantly reduces perceived stress in working adults. Higher energy expenditure through exercise correlates with lower likelihood of experiencing moderate to high stress levels.
